Output 44e6bdefc330db18d21a8f2cdef1b5e857e7601eb309c998c3cfbdae18f1e603:9

value
928486816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ee499c5c55c07a973a460de34a8de548062aebb1 OP_EQUAL
address
3PQxvmQApmGfcp8Phw9RshFj6yDt21FNfU
transaction
44e6bdefc330db18d21a8f2cdef1b5e857e7601eb309c998c3cfbdae18f1e603
spent
true